What is a Baskt User?

In Baskt, a user represents an entity (a person or an application) that can connect to your bucket through the SFTP protocol. Once you add a user, they will be able to log in via SFTP with their credentials and manage files within their designated home directory.

Creating a User

  1. Navigate to your bucket’s page
  2. Click on the “Create my first user” button
  3. Fill out the form with your user’s details (username, password)
  4. Specify a “home” directory for the user
    • This directory acts as the user’s root. They will be unable to navigate or access files outside of this directory.
    • Restricting users to their home directory ensures they only have access to the files they need, enhancing security and privacy.
    • You can leave this field blank to grant the user full access to the entire bucket.
  5. Click “Create user”

And there you have it! Your first user is now set up and ready to start transferring files.
